***DO YOU HAVE EXPERIENCE IN THE LETTINGS INDUSTRY***We are in need of an experienced Property ManagerEarlsdon - CoventryBasic Salary up to 26k - 28k Dependant on experience + Comms to OTE 30kCar allowance £150 per month + Business mileage allowanceOTE £30,000Start Spring with the local Boutique Estate Agent focused on speed, delivery and efficiency. If you have experience in the Lettings industry and seek a new challenging role then we have an opening for a Tenancy and Property Manager helping to managea portfolio of properties.* What you’d be doing Day to Day:- Work closely with your Property Management team ensuring all properties are legal, safe and ready for occupation- Deliver a five-star service to our landlords and tenants through the life cycle of a fully managed property- Carry out Pre-Tenancy Inspections- Undertake administrative tasks, keeping records and logs up to date- Develop strong, long-term relationships with our Landlords and Tenants, ensuring we retain and develop all possible business opportunities- Checking works are completed and keeping all parties updated - Helping at the end of tenancies including communication relating to deposit returns- Resolving issues quickly and efficiently- Understands the importance of improving the quality of our portfolio by actively promoting our refurbishments team- Remain up to date with relevant legislation- Attending regular morning meetings with relevant Lettings teams in their offices, ensuring excellent communication between teamsRequirements & Skills:- Strong negotiator with excellent communication skills- Previous property management experience essential- Able to deliver excellent customer service experience- Strong attention to detail- Persistent and tenacious- Team player- Natural ability to trouble shoot with a keen desire to succeed- Ability to cope well under pressureClient servicing, building and maintaining successful client relationships, planning and organising, ability to multi task are key attributes to our practice. In addition to which you will be of smart appearance with professional communication skills, goodknowledge of Lettings regulations and contractual agreements and local market with an ability to work under pressure, propose and implement initiatives and competent in using Microsoft word. A clean driving licence with use of a vehicle is necessary.The Humphrey Group are a specialist Recruiter for the property industry and place excellent people in appropriate roles to reach their full potential and follow their dreams.
